You think of an inspirational speaker and they will use the ‘Power of 3’ in their speeches.

The power of 3 is an effective way to A: Structure your speeches (think start/middle/end),   B: Share information in a way they helps you and the audience recall your message (e.g. my favourite foods are: 1. Pasta, 2. Fish, 3. Pineapple). C:  Makes your speech sound more structured, engaging and attractive from the viewpoint of the listener.  So do give it a try.
